About the role
- Project Delivery - supporting the delivery of agreed consulting engagements / projects on time, on budget, and to high standards of quality.
- Technical Analysis - supporting project work and providing expert viewpoint and quality assurance on deliverables as needed.
- Client Relationship Building - supporting the team with building the confidence and trust of client teams and representing our direct clients’ interests effectively inside their organisations.
- Deliverable Drafting C Presentation - preparing and delivering high quality reports, presentations, and sometimes workshops in line with project scope. This includes report writing (e.g., SR, IR, CR) for clients.
- Supporting the development of proposals on assessing ESG and Reporting opportunities, and contributing to the presentation and conversion of these opportunities, in collaboration with the guidance and support of colleagues.
- Service development - develop new service offerings and/or streamlining and improving existing service offerings including creating delivery and proposal templates, providing training and acting as internal expert on a specific service.
- Contributing to the development of Anthesis’ thought leadership and marketing materials in relation to ESG and Reporting.
- Training & Personal Development – periodically learning new sustainability related skills and services, using the ACE (Anthesis Centre of Excellence) learning and development platform and guided by your line manager.
- Strategic Organisational Initiatives – contributing to important internal initiatives, proposition development, and innovation of our services and capabilities to make Anthesis a more impactful driver of change.
Requirements
- A degree/relevant qualification in a related field (sustainability/climate change, environmental science, business, engineering, finance, governance/policy, etc.)
- At least 5 years of experience in various sustainability advisory fundamentals, such as double materiality assessments, ESG strategy setting, ESG reporting, human rights, climate risk, or others.
- A passion for sustainability and an interest in being at the forefront of guiding corporate transition to a more sustainable economy.
- Curious, open minded and enthusiastic with clear ability to collaborate and work well with a wide range of people on a global basis.
- Good communication skills to work in with the team, ask for help when required and to work independently.
- Specialization in one of and familiarity with other various mandatory and voluntary reporting frameworks such as GRI, SASB, IR, TCFD, UNGPs, ASRS AASB S1 C S2, IFRS S1 C S2 or other related ESG standards. At least 3 years outlining/building content and writing sustainability reports following at least 3 of these reporting frameworks.
- Drafting reports and presentations that convey key messages, inform strategic decision-making and deliver impact-led conclusions.
- Ability to analyse, write about, and advise upon economic, regulatory, and sustainability-related subjects.
- Ability to respond positively to pressure and take a flexible approach to the dynamic, fast moving sustainability reporting sector.
- Strong communication and writing skills and working familiarity with MS Office Suite is required, with high levels of numeracy and good
- Excel programming and workbook skills preferred.
